Luis Muñoz Marín International Airport (SJU) has four terminals: Terminals A through D. Here's which terminal your airline departs from, the SJU terminal map, how to get between terminals, and where security is — so you walk in knowing exactly where to go.

At SJUyou can move between terminals on foot or by the airport's inter-terminal connector — follow the signage. A terminal change can mean re-clearing security, so leave yourself a cushion.
Give yourself a real cushion to connect at SJU: about 45–60 minutes for a domestic-to-domestic connection, and 90 minutes or more when international travel or a terminal change is involved. See our full guide to minimum connection time.
